#Подключение self-hosted Битрикс24
Self-hosted (коробочный) Битрикс24 — это Битрикс24, который заказчик разворачивает на своём сервере, а не в облаке bitrix24.{ru,de,com,kz,by}. Чтобы Вайбкод мог работать с таким порталом — обращаться к CRM, задачам, ботам, выписывать вебхуки — нужен личный developer-key на стороне self-hosted Битрикс24.
С 2026-05-11 подключение делается в два клика, через бот-компаньон. Раньше нужно было просить администратора self-hosted Битрикс24 вручную выписать developer-key и копипастить URL вебхука на платформу — этот сценарий удалён.
#Как это работает
Подключение делается один раз для портала + по одному клику для каждого пользователя.
#Шаг 1. Администратор self-hosted Битрикс24 — один раз для портала
Этот шаг делает любой пользователь self-hosted Битрикс24 с ролью администратора.
- Откройте административный интерфейс self-hosted Битрикс24
- Установите модуль VibeCode Connector (если ещё не установлен) — он бесплатный, доступен в разделе модулей Битрикс24
- Откройте настройки модуля
- Нажмите кнопку «Подключить портал к Вайбкоду»
- Дождитесь окончания процесса (обычно 5–15 секунд) — модуль зарегистрирует портал на Вайбкоде, выпишет admin developer-key, установит приложение vibecode и зарегистрирует бот-компаньон
Этот шаг делается один раз на портал. После этого любой пользователь self-hosted Битрикс24 может подключить себя к Вайбкоду через шаг 2 — повторно дёргать админа уже не нужно.
#Шаг 2. Пользователь Вайбкода — один клик
После того как администратор сделал шаг 1, любой пользователь Вайбкода (включая самого администратора) может подключить свою учётную запись self-hosted Битрикс24.
- Откройте Вайбкод, перейдите в раздел Порталы
- Нажмите «Подключить self-hosted Битрикс24»
- Введите адрес self-hosted Битрикс24 (например,
mybox.example.com) и нажмите «Продолжить» - Вайбкод проверит, что портал зарегистрирован, и покажет ссылку «Открыть бот в self-hosted Битрикс24»
- Нажмите ссылку — откроется чат с бот-компаньоном Вайбкода в вашем self-hosted Битрикс24
- Бот покажет карточку с вашим именем и email из Вайбкода и две кнопки: «Да, это я» / «Нет, это не я»
- Нажмите «Да, это я» — Вайбкод выпишет ваш личный developer-key и автоматически перенаправит вас на дашборд портала
Готово. С этого момента ваши скрипты, агенты и приложения на Вайбкоде могут обращаться к этому self-hosted Битрикс24 от вашего имени.
#Состояния мастера подключения
При подключении мастер на стороне Вайбкода проходит через несколько состояний:
| Состояние | Что видит пользователь | Что происходит |
|---|---|---|
| A — ввод адреса | Поле «Адрес self-hosted Битрикс24» | Пользователь указывает домен |
| B — открыт бот | Ссылка «Открыть бот в self-hosted Битрикс24», ссылка действительна 10 минут | Pair-code создан, ждём подтверждения в боте |
| C — успех | «self-hosted Битрикс24 подключён», auto-redirect | Пользователь нажал «Да» в боте, developer-key выписан |
| D — портал не зарегистрирован | «Вайбкод не знает этот self-hosted Битрикс24» с инструкцией шага 1 | Модуль vibecodeconnector ещё не активирован — попросите администратора |
| E — отклонено / истекло | «Подтверждение отклонено» или «Код подтверждения истёк» | Пользователь нажал «Нет» в боте, либо прошло 10 минут — можно начать заново |
#Что делать в типичных ситуациях
#«Вайбкод не знает этот self-hosted Битрикс24» (состояние D)
Этот портал ещё не зарегистрирован на платформе. Попросите администратора self-hosted Битрикс24 выполнить шаг 1: установить модуль vibecodeconnector и нажать «Подключить портал к Вайбкоду». После этого вернитесь на Вайбкод и нажмите кнопку «Я подключил — повторить».
#Бот пишет «Запрос на привязку отклонён» — а вы ничего не отклоняли
Возможно, кто-то другой пытается привязать ваш self-hosted Битрикс24 к своей учётной записи на Вайбкоде. Если запрос пришёл неожиданно — это правильно, что вы нажали «Нет». Сообщите администратору self-hosted Битрикс24: возможно, идёт попытка социальной инженерии.
#Бот пишет «Код подтверждения истёк» — пропустил 10 минут
Pair-code действует 10 минут. Если не успели — просто откройте Вайбкод, нажмите «Подключить self-hosted Битрикс24» и пройдите процесс заново.
#«Кнопка устарела» — нажимаю «Да», а ничего не происходит
Скорее всего, вы повторно открыли старое сообщение от бота — за это время уже создан новый pair-code (например, если открывали Вайбкод в нескольких вкладках). Откройте Вайбкод, проверьте, что мастер показывает свежий pair-code, и нажмите ссылку «Открыть бот в self-hosted Битрикс24» заново.
#Кнопка «Подключить self-hosted Битрикс24» не появляется
Функция раскатывается постепенно. Если в вашем личном кабинете кнопки нет — возможно, функция полностью выключена (off) на стороне платформы; обратитесь к администратору платформы.
В режиме pilot кнопка видна всем пользователям с пометкой «бета» рядом, а внутри окна подключения отображается информационный баннер «доступно ограниченному количеству порталов» — это значит, что фича работает, но мы пока разворачиваем её плавно. В режиме on кнопка отображается так же, без значка и баннера.
#Бот не появился в моём self-hosted Битрикс24
После шага 1 модуль vibecodeconnector регистрирует бот-компаньона автоматически. Если бот не появился, возможно произошла ошибка на одном из шагов активации (mint admin-key / install app / register bot). Администратор self-hosted Битрикс24 может повторно нажать «Подключить портал к Вайбкоду» — процесс идемпотентен, повторное нажатие пройдёт только те шаги, которые упали.
#Безопасность
- Карточка инициатора в боте — это защитный механизм, а не косметика. Бот всегда показывает имя и email пользователя Вайбкода, который запросил привязку. Если вы не узнаёте этого пользователя — нажмите «Нет, это не я», и developer-key не будет выписан.
- Pair-code действует 10 минут и одноразовый — после подтверждения он сразу аннулируется. Перехват ссылки бесполезен через 10 минут или после первого подтверждения.
- Developer-key хранится зашифрованным. В API-ответах всегда возвращается только подсказка (последние 4 символа), сам ключ не отдаётся ни одному клиенту.
- SSRF-защита. Адреса вида
localhost,127.0.0.1, IP-литералы и приватные диапазоны отвергаются на этапе ввода — Вайбкод не разрешает указать вместо self-hosted Битрикс24 свой собственный backend.
#После подключения
Подключённый self-hosted Битрикс24 ведёт себя так же, как cloud-портал:
- Создавайте API-ключи в разделе Ключи API — они работают через те же эндпоинты
/v1/* - Создавайте OAuth-приложения в разделе Приложения — пользователи получают свой developer-key автоматически по такому же bot-pairing процессу
- Запускайте AI-агентов и AI Router — для self-hosted порталов работают те же модели и пайплайны
- Используйте веб-поиск, билинг, аналитику — без ограничений по сравнению с cloud
Особенности self-hosted (важно):
- Скоупы реальные. На self-hosted Битрикс24 скоупы вебхуков enforce'ятся со стороны самого портала — попытка вызвать метод вне скоупа вернёт 403. На cloud скоупы advisory (Вайбкод фильтрует, B24 нет).
- Тариф всегда commercial. self-hosted Битрикс24 — это платная лицензия, поэтому trial Вайбкода для таких порталов не активируется.
- Несколько пользователей одного self-hosted Битрикс24 — каждый делает шаг 2 индивидуально и получает свой личный developer-key. Учётные записи независимые: revocation одного ключа не затрагивает других.
#Если что-то пошло не так
Откройте раздел Обратная связь на Вайбкоде или напишите в поддержку. В тикете укажите:
- Адрес self-hosted Битрикс24 (например,
mybox.example.com) - На каком шаге зависло (A / B / C / D / E)
- Текст ошибки, если бот её показал
- Время попытки (примерно)
С этой информацией мы сможем найти ваш request в audit-log и разобраться быстрее.
#Что дальше
- Быстрый старт — создайте первый ключ и попробуйте API
- Ключи и авторизация — типы ключей, скоупы, лимиты
- Entity API — CRUD по сущностям Битрикс24
- Бот-платформа — создание чат-ботов на Вайбкоде